Arancini is a classic Italian Finger Food. These are stuffed Rice balls coated with Bread Crumb. Today Arachini is with twist with our "Khichdi","Achar"and.

Sabudana khichdi recipe With video and step by step photos. Sabudana ki khichdi Is usually made during fasting days like Navratri or mahashivratri or Ekadashi. It is an easy snack and is a good recipe to be made during fasting days but it requires little experience to get the perfect nonsticky texture in. An elaborate yet easy khichdi that makes a wholesome and delicious meal, the dal khichdi is made of toor dal and rice combined with not just whole spices but also onions, garlic and tomatoes.
This imparts a tangy twist to the toor dal khichdi making it holistic in terms of taste too. Make sure you top your dal.
